The Fact About what is md5's application That No One Is Suggesting

MD5 is usually a greatly made use of hash purpose that generates a concept digest (or hash value) of 128 bits in length. It absolutely was to begin with made to be a cryptographic hash function but, in a afterwards stage vulnerabilities had been identified and so isn't regarded appropriate for cryptographic applications.

Remain Informed: Stay updated on the latest stability finest techniques and rising threats to adapt and boost safety measures.

The values for B, C and D are whatever the outputs with the prior Procedure were being, much like ahead of. For any refresher on Boolean algebra:

Should the First input was 448 bits or bigger, it would need to be break up into two or even more 512-bit blocks. In the very first block, the enter might be extra basically the same way Now we have explained during. The only change is available in the final move.

This means that our enter, M, can be an enter in Every of those four phases. Even so, in advance of it may be used as an enter, our 512-little bit M has to be break up into sixteen 32-bit “phrases”. Each and every of those terms is assigned its possess range, starting from M0 to M15. Inside our illustration, these 16 words are:

MD5 hashes are prone to rainbow table attacks, which are precomputed tables of hash values utilized to reverse-engineer weak or common passwords.

Inertia: Relying on MD5 in legacy devices can develop inertia, which makes it more difficult to upgrade or modernize these devices iwin when vital.

Boolean algebra performs in another way to typical algebra. When you are bewildered by The entire system, you might have to perform some track record research in the Boolean algebra site we connected over. Usually, you’ll just need to rely on us.

Many data breaches concerned attackers exploiting MD5 vulnerabilities in hashed password databases. At the time they attained the hashed passwords, they employed pre-graphic assaults to reveal the plaintext passwords, putting person accounts at risk.

While MD5 and SHA are both hashing algorithms, their usefulness in securing passwords depends intensely on how the hashes are utilised. A critical element in safe password hashing is salting. Salting involves adding a random string (a salt) to the password right before it really is hashed.

Safety Vulnerabilities: Continuing to work with MD5 in legacy systems exposes Those people techniques to acknowledged security vulnerabilities, together with collision and pre-impression attacks, that may be exploited by attackers.

Details Breach Hazard: If a legacy procedure with MD5 is compromised, delicate details may be uncovered, bringing about details breaches and reputational destruction.

com. As component of the plan, we may possibly get paid a commission if you come up with a purchase by means of our affiliate inbound links.

Legacy Programs: Older methods and software program which have not been current may possibly proceed to utilize MD5 for numerous purposes, together with authentication. These devices might not pose an immediate hazard When they are effectively-isolated and not subjected to exterior threats.

Leave a Reply

Your email address will not be published. Required fields are marked *